#4dc562 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4dc562 is composed of 30.2% red, 77.3% green and 38.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 60.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 50.3% yellow and 22.7% black. It has a hue angle of 130.5 degrees, a saturation of 50.8% and a lightness of 53.7%. #4dc562 color hex could be obtained by blending #9affc4 with #008b00.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

Shades and Tints of #4dc562

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050e06 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.
